Ensuring Account Security
Account security should be a top priority for any online user. Beyond a strong password and 2FA, consider utilizing a password manager to generate and store complex passwords for all your online accounts. Regularly update your account details, including your email address and phone number, to ensure you can always recover your account if needed. Avoid using the same password across multiple platforms, as this can create a vulnerability. Be cautious of phishing attempts, which often involve fraudulent emails or messages designed to trick you into revealing your login credentials. Never click on suspicious links or download attachments from unknown sources. A key aspect of securing your account involves being vigilant and proactive in protecting your personal information.

Troubleshooting Common Login Issues
Even with a correctly created account, users may encounter issues when attempting to log in. Common problems include forgotten passwords, incorrect usernames, and technical glitches on the platform’s end. Most platforms offer a “Forgot Password” option, which typically involves providing your registered email address to receive a password reset link. This link will allow you to create a new, secure password. However, if you no longer have access to the registered email address, contacting customer support is the best course of action. Another frequent issue is a simple typo in your username or password. Double-check that Caps Lock is off and that you have entered your credentials correctly. Clearing your browser’s cache and cookies can also resolve login issues, as these stored files can sometimes interfere with the login process.

Understanding Two-Factor Authentication
Two-factor authentication (2FA) is a vital security measure that adds an extra layer of protection to your account. After entering your username and password, 2FA requires a second form of verification, typically a code sent to your phone or email. This code changes frequently, making it difficult for unauthorized users to gain access to your account, even if they have obtained your password. There are several types of 2FA, including SMS codes, authenticator apps (like Google Authenticator or Authy), and security keys (like YubiKey). Authenticator apps are generally considered more secure than SMS codes, as SMS messages can be intercepted. Enabling 2FA is a simple yet effective way to significantly enhance your account security.
